1. Vent Hood Type and Performance

Appliance style is the first cost variable.

• Under-cabinet hoods: The most economical option, averaging $250–$450 for the unit.

• Wall-mounted chimney hoods: Expect $400–$800 for the appliance, depending on CFM and finish.

• Island hoods: With 360° capture and decorative styling, units range from $600–$1,500.

• Professional-grade or custom hoods: Restaurant-level airflow can push the unit price above $2,000.

2. Ducted vs. Ductless Configuration

• Ducted systems exhaust outdoors and meet most code requirements for gas ranges. They involve galvanized or stainless ductwork, exterior caps and additional labor.

• Ductless (recirculating) hoods use charcoal filters to trap grease and odor, eliminating roof or wall penetrations but requiring long-term filter maintenance.

On average, switching from ductless to ducted adds $300–$700 in materials and labor. When you speak your project details into CountBricks Voice, the software automatically flags these premiums and adjusts totals.

3. Duct Run Length and Complexity

A straight 3-foot vertical run costs far less than a 15-foot horizontal chase with multiple elbows. Friction losses also dictate the need for larger diameter duct and higher CFM.

• Straight, short run: $150–$250 in duct materials, 2–3 labor hours.

• Moderate run with two elbows: $250–$400 in materials, 4–6 labor hours.

• Long run or concealed chase: $400–$700+ in materials, 8–12 labor hours plus drywall repair.

4. Structural Modifications

Older homes may need joist notching, soffit removal or chase framing. These hidden tasks can add $200–$1,000 to the total. CountBricks itemizes each modification in its task list so homeowners understand why costs rise.

5. Electrical and Mechanical Requirements

• Dedicated 120 V circuit or upgrade to GFCI/AFCI protection: $150–$300.

• Makeup air system for high-CFM hoods (often required above 400 CFM): $500–$1,500.

• Fire-rated backer boards or heat shields behind pro-style ranges: $75–$150.

6. Labor Rates by Region

Residential labor averages vary dramatically:

• Rural areas: $55–$65 per electrician hour, $45–$60 per carpenter hour.

• Suburban metros: $70–$90 electrician, $60–$80 carpenter.

• Major cities: $95–$130 electrician, $80–$110 carpenter.

Total Hood Vent Installation Cost Range

Bringing all factors together, most single-family projects fall into three tiers:

• Basic replacement (existing duct, under-cabinet hood): $600–$1,000.

• Mid-range remodel (new duct, wall-mount hood): $1,200–$2,000.

• High-end upgrade (island hood, long duct, makeup air): $2,500–$4,500.
